As promised, Imangi Studios has released its Temple Run successor Temple Run 2 in the Google Play today. Available now for free download, the game has already been download more than 20 million times from Apple iTunes store.
Temple Run 2 brings the same gameplay as the original Temple Run, but the visuals and animations have been revamped. The new game includes four characters and a bunch of upgradable abilities.
According to Imangi, the original Temple Run has clocked over 170 million downloads till date.
Temple Run 2 features:
- Beautiful new graphics
- Gorgeous new organic environments
- New obstacles
- More powerups
- More achievements
- Special powers for each character
- Bigger monkey
Size: 33MB
Support: Android 2.1 or above
Hands on:
Temple Run 2 is better than the processor in almost every aspect. The visual and animation are nicer and you get a better feel. It is comparatively harder (until you get used to), so you get the feeling that you are playing a totally new game.
Imangi has clearly put in work to make Temple Run 2 more fun and interesting. You no longer run in straight lines, there are stairs, rope-ways, curvy paths, elevations, water-falls and a lot more.
But when you have played the game for some-time, it gets monotonous.
